The analysis, led by the College of Bristol, found a brand new model of communication that would assist construct and preserve a constructive relationship with well being professionals, growing belief and public confidence. Its findings, simply printed on Tuesday within the journal Well being Psychology entitled “The empathetic refutational interview to sort out vaccine misconceptions: 4 randomized experiments” discovered that greater than two-thirds of vaccine-hesitant research contributors who acquired empathetic engagement from a healthcare skilled most popular this in contrast with a gaggle who had been simply informed the info.
Lead writer Dr. Daybreak Holford, a senior psychology analysis affiliate, mentioned: “Though we anticipated individuals to usually reply extra positively to an empathetic method, it was stunning how a lot larger the desire for this model of communication was amongst those that expressed considerations about vaccination. Our research highlights how the manner misinformation is tackled, particularly with vaccine-averse teams, can play a significant function in altering perceptions which will be exhausting to shift.”
The research, which concerned greater than 2,500 contributors within the UK and US, in contrast their response to direct, factual communication with a novel dialogue-based approach empathizing with their views, whereas additionally addressing false or deceptive anti-vaccination arguments.
The outcomes of the brand new method
The outcomes confirmed contributors total most popular the brand new method, often called “empathetic refutational interviewing” – and this response was strongest for the vaccine-hesitant, who discovered it extra compelling than being introduced purely with info.
Two-thirds of the contributors who skilled the empathetic refutational interview additionally indicated they had been extra keen to proceed the dialog with a healthcare skilled, and round 12% grew to become extra keen to be vaccinated in comparison with these contributors who acquired the factual method.
The interview approach includes a four-step course of. First, the affected person is invited to share their ideas and considerations about vaccination in order that healthcare professionals can perceive their motivations and reservations. Then understanding and belief are constructed by affirming the affected person’s emotions and considerations. Third, a tailor-made rationalization is offered to problem misconceptions, providing a truthful various to any misinformed beliefs. Lastly, related info about vaccination are offered, equivalent to how they’ll profit the person by guarding towards illness in addition to collectively defending others by lowering the unfold and constructing vaccine-induced herd immunity.
Holford defined that “our findings actively exhibit the facility of communication that healthcare professionals can use of their day by day roles. Our research exhibits it’s attainable to achieve belief and alter minds if we take individuals’s considerations severely and tailor our method to assist them make knowledgeable selections about their well being. That is massively encouraging, particularly with the rising affect of misinformation and faux information worldwide.”
